Five injured as man opens fire on Hisbah officials in Katsina

by Editorial Team
1 April 2025
in News

The Katsina State Police Command has arrested Alhaji Surajo Mai Asharalle and three others for allegedly attacking Hisbah officials and causing severe injuries during a late-night enforcement operation at Kofar Kaura Quarters of the state.

 

According to sources from the CPS Katsina, the Operations Officer of the Katsina State Hisbah Board, Nafi’u Aliyu Akilu, reported that at about 2:30 a.m. on March 29, 2025, Hisbah officials were dispatched to stop a group of youths playing football near a mosque where Tahajjud (night prayers) were ongoing. 

 

However, upon arrival, the youths resisted and chased the Hisbah officials away. 

 

During the confrontation, Alhaji Surajo Mai Asharalle allegedly fired multiple shots from a locally made cut-to-size gun, injuring five Hisbah officials: Aminu Musa Yari, Muhammad Ibrahim, Yau Musa Ingawa, Kabir Abdullahi and Mustapha Isa.

 

In addition, a Peugeot 206 (blue) and a Mercedes C180, which were parked at the scene, were severely damaged. 

 

Police later mobilized to the scene, arrested the suspect and three accomplices, and recovered the firearm used in the attack. 

 

The injured victims were rushed to General Hospital Katsina and later referred to Federal Teaching Hospital (FTH) Katsina for further treatment.
